Are people in Reading older or younger than people in Jenkintown?- The Median Age in Reading is 12.2 years younger than in Jenkintown.
Are housing costs cheaper in Reading or Jenkintown?- Reading
housing costs are 52.9% less expensive than Jenkintown hous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Reading or Jenkintown?- The average commute for residents of Reading is 3.9 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Jenkintown.

Things to do in Reading?Reading, Pennsylvania is located in the heart of Berks County and has been a thriving hub for culture and commerce since its founding in 1748. It's home to many museums and landmarks such as the Reading Public Museum or the Pagoda; visitors will also find plenty of great shopping, dining, and entertainment options.
